"La paix a tout prix" (Peace at Any Price) is a satirical lithograph created by Honoré Daumier in 1870. The artwork depicts a soldier forced to carry a large, cumbersome peace symbol, suggesting that peace comes at a heavy cost. Daumier, a renowned artist and social commentator, used his work to critique political and social issues of his time. This piece is a poignant reminder of the complexities of war and the sacrifices required to achieve peace. The satirical nature of the image made it a popular critique of the political climate in the 19th century.
